Historical Dillon Home

Beautiful home in the heart of the historic district! Two story home offers three bedrooms (1 queen bed, 2 full beds), office, and full bath (walk-in shower and purple tub) upstairs. Main level has a pull-out sofa bed, spacious front room, dining area, kitchen, powder room, and utility room with washer and dryer. Outdoor space includes a nice fenced yard with patio. Elkhorn Hot Springs - Polaris, MT

Historic Cabins, Lodge and Natural Springs

Elkhorn Hot Springs is a rustic, heartfelt Montanan getaway situated in the Grasshopper Valley just south of Dillon Montana. Providing rental cabins, and fine dining at lodge and Hot Springs for a great relaxing time in the healing waters. Our Favorite Places to Explore Nearby:
  • Bannack Ghost Town – Montana’s First Territorial Capital – A must stop on the way to the Byway – Approximate time is ½ hour to a hour)
  • Pioneer Mountains Scenic Byway (Groomed snowmobile trails)
    • Panoramic Grasshopper Valley in the Pioneer and Beaverhead Mountains
    • Polaris, MT – Old time US Post Office still stands with Polar Bar.
  • Comet Mountain and Elkhorn Mine
  • Crystal Park for a day of rockhounding
  • Lupine Day Use Cabin and warming hut during snowmobile season
  • Coolidge Ghost Town
